If Only I Knew is a candid and practical guide designed to demystify the complexities of fertility treatment. Written by two fertility experts with decades of experience—both personal and professional—this book offers a practical, honest guide that empowers readers to take control of their treatment with confidence and clarity. Infertility affects 1 in 6 people globally, which means that roughly 48 million couples and 186 million individuals worldwide are currently living with infertility, Fertility treatment is one of the most emotionally challenging journeys, yet it’s one that too often leaves people feeling isolated, uninformed, and overwhelmed. If Only I Knew changes that. Drawing from years of professional experience and countless conversations with patients, the book highlights the essential information often overlooked—how fertility medications truly affect patients, the meaning behind test results, the hidden challenges that can arise during treatment, and more.

Dr Louise Goddard-Crawley is a Chartered Psychologist (CPsychol) and Associate Fellow of the British Psychological Society (AFBPsS), Louise specialises in health and fertility psychology. She is also a former fertility nurse, combining decades of psychological expertise with hands-on experience supporting individuals and couples through fertility treatment. Jules McDonald has over 20 years of international experience in patient care and has become a trusted expert in fertility nursing. She has supported patients across every stage of their treatment, including those who once thought parenthood was out of reach.
